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
112671 77 55886570214 31 69
33836 83617768361
33836 83617768361
346589 87085270084 565
All about undefined
Interested in learning more?
33836 83617768361
346589 87085270084 565
See more
958283262 37216657 50
39449303 96567 667 885156085
See more
2864247 83026 26136741
598984 694213420 856 564217
See more